Automatic trading system for trading with commodities
Brábník, Petr ; Stoklásek, Libor (referee) ; Budík, Jan (advisor)
This thesis deals with problems of automatic trading system for trading on commodity exchange. Automated trading system for the purpose of this thesis is based on the principle of adaptive moving average. This principle is processed initially at a theoretical level, then the thesis analyzes the problem of making automated trading system and risks of online trading. The final section describes implementation and testing of automatic trading system.

Automated Trading System for Commodity Markets
Kliment, Vojtěch ; Novotná, Veronika (referee) ; Budík, Jan (advisor)
This master’s thesis primary deals with a design and a development of own automated trading system which is specialized for commodity markets, especially corn, soybean, wheat and slightly for gold. You can find theoretical basics of technical analysis here, then technical indicators, risk management and trading systems themselves. System is completely designed and programmed in MetaTrader trading platform with using programming language MQL and genetic algorithms. The output of this thesis is portfolio containing six trading strategies which achieved totally 42,4 % increase in three months at the end of year 2014.
Design of Automatic Trading Systém Based on Fractal Geometry
Malý, Petr ; Dostál, Petr (referee) ; Budík, Jan (advisor)
This thesis deals with an analysis and prediction of foreign exchange markets. The thesis is based on the fractal market hypothesis and it uses tools based on fractal geometry for prediction of markets. The thesis also describes ways of using advanced methods of artificial intelligence for analyzing markets. The outcome is designed and implemented automatic trading system. The thesis also deals with testing of designed system on historical data and on the latest data as well.
